Israeli Soldier Wounds Palestinian Near Faku'a; Live Fire Rules Under Review

An Israeli soldier shot and wounded a Palestinian man near the village of Faku'a in northern Samaria, an area near the separation line. The incident began when Palestinians reportedly started throwing stones at an Israeli shepherd near the "Zait be-Gilboa" farm. Soldiers arrived to assist the shepherd. According to a security source cited by Galey Tzahal correspondent Doron Kashdow, one soldier initially fired into the air to disperse the crowd. Subsequently, the soldier fired at a Palestinian man, wounding him. The source indicated that at the time of the shooting, the Palestinian was no longer throwing stones and did not pose a threat, suggesting the soldier fired in violation of regulations.

The injured Palestinian was transported to a hospital by the Red Crescent. The IDF stated that the command is investigating the incident and that the findings will be forwarded to the relevant authorities for review. The "Zait be-Gilboa" farm was established in the area several weeks ago and is located near Faku'a.
